Description

To be offered for sale by Public Auction, subject to prior sale, special conditions and reserve at The Salwey Arms, Woofferton, Ludlow SY8 4AL, Tuesday, 16th September 2025 at 6pm.

A rare opportunity to purchase a substantial Grade II listed character property along with a wide array of traditional farm buildings, for renovation, offering a ‘blank canvas’ for developers within a highly desired rural village. The holding comprises of a former mill, three-bedroom cottage, two large modern workshops, a courtyard of traditional farm building and approximately 7 acres of amenity land. EPC ‘Exempt’. The property occupies a peripheral setting of the rural village of Clunton, within the Shropshire Hills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ty (AONB), renowned for its scenic unblemished countryside, it is a true haven, relishing excellent rural walks and bridleways along the nearby Shropshire Way, and open countryside views across to Clunton Coppice. The property sits in secluded yet very accessible location just off the B4368. The charming village of Clunton, offering the popular country inn The Crown Inn, and the St Marys Church. The village is surrounded by unspoilt countryside offering outdoor pursuits including nearby Bury Ditches Iron Age Hill Fort, a registered monument loved by walkers for its summit views! The closest amenities can be found in Clun or in Aston on Clun where there is a village shop and garage.

Clunton Mill is a charming, traditional timber-framed stone cottage with a Grade II listing. It is situated down a private, cherry tree-lined driveway, surrounded by mature trees, garden, and the River Clun. Currently, the property requires renovations; and there is potential to connect the house to the former stone and brick-built mill. Please note that no formal applications for a change of use or planning permission have been submitted at this stage. Any necessary consents would need to be obtained. The property retains original detailing throughout, with the mill featuring notable timber work and the historic mill and millworks adding significant character. Overall, this unique property offers a peaceful retreat with considerable potential. It is important to note that the property has experienced flooding in the past, and prospective purchasers should consider measures to mitigate this risk, whilst working alongside listing and planning officers.

The property features a spacious rural mini-estate spanning just under 7 acres. The main residence is a three-bedroom country cottage complemented by a family bathroom, farmhouse kitchen, and three reception rooms. The extensive grounds include a large garden, a double garage, and a loft with a lean-to. The property is enhanced by the picturesque mill pond and stream that flow through an early 19th-century former mill. This historic mill spans over three floors and retains many of its original workings, adding charm and character to the property. Additional outbuildings include a two-storey SPF timber-clad workshop equipped with power and lighting, a two-storey timber pole barn with corrugated roofing, and a traditional two-storey brick barn with corrugated iron cladding, complemented by an attached stone barn.

*Guide Price: An indication of a seller's minimum expectation at auction and given as a “Guide Price” or a range of “Guide Prices”. This is not necessarily the figure a property will sell for and is subject to change prior to the auction.

Reserve Price: Each auction property will be subject to a “Reserve Price” below which the property cannot be sold at auction. Normally the “Reserve Price” will be set within the range of “Guide Prices” or no more than 10% above a single “Guide Price.”
